| Vision: Student Absences Page Upgraded |
Analysis > Grid Data > Student Absences |
The Student Absences page has been upgraded to improve speed and usability. What’s NewThe bottom right of the list page now shows you how many records are in the list and allows you to jump from page to page. Each page contains 100 entries to ensure fast loading. |
| Census – School: New Data Check Reports | Modules > Census > School | For schools in England, you can now run Data Check Reports in the School census by selecting a Return, clicking on Reports and choosing either On Roll or Leavers from the dropdown list. |

| wTimetable – Performance Enhancements | Timetable Module – Performance Enhancements | We have introduced a range of performance enhancements across the wTimetable module to deliver a faster, smoother, and more responsive experience – particularly to support larger or more complex datasets. |
| Dashboards – Take Register Enhancements (New Interface) | Home > Teacher Dashboard > Student List > Take Register |
The following enhancements have been added to the Take Register New Interface:
New Icons
Two additional icons – Seating Plan and Attendance Mark Protection – are now available in the new interface. These were previously only accessible in the Week View of the old interface.
– Seating Plan
Opens the Seating Plan in a new tab.
The Seating Plan will open in either the new or old UI depending on the configuration set in Config > Setup > System Settings > New UI Settings.
– Attendance Mark Protection
When enabled, prevents attendance marks from being overwritten. The button can be toggled on and off. The icon will appear blue while active.
The default setting can be configured in Config >Attendance >Registration Options > Rolling Register Options > Default Attendance Mark Protection.
New Actions
The following actions – Assessment and Dinner Register – have been introduced to the new interface. – Assessment
Opens the Assessment Marksheet in a new tab.
– Dinner Register
Opens the Dinner Register popup. Permission can be enabled in Config > Setup > Roles and Permissions under the Framework module and People > Students > Dinner Register.
